The world of creation
(from the Mother's
Agenda)
The world of
creation has several levels or degrees. It's at the very summit
of human consciousness, on the borderline between what Sri
Aurobindo calls the lower and the higher hemispheres. It is very
high, very high.
The first zone you
encounter is the zone of painting, sculpture, architecture:
everything that has a material form. It is the zone of forms,
coloured forms that are expressed as paintings, sculptures, and
architecture. They are not forms as we know them, but rather
typal forms; you can see garden types, for instance, wonderfully
coloured and beautiful, or construction types.
Then comes the
musical zone, and there you find the origin of the sounds that
have inspired the various composers. Great waves of music,
without sound. It seems a bit strange, but that's how it is
Beyond the musical zone lies thought: thoughts, organised
thoughts for plays and books, abstractions for philosophies. But
what used to interest me particularly were the combinations that
give birth to novels or plays.
That is the third
zone.
What you find there
are thought formations that are expressed in each person's brain
in his own language...It is the domain of pure thought. That's
where you work when you want to work for the whole earth; you
don't send out thoughts formulated in words, you send out a pure
thought, which then formulates itself in any language in any
brain: in all those who are receptive. These formations are at
anyone's disposal - nobody can say, "It's MY idea, it's MY
book." Anyone capable of ascending to that zone can get
hold of the formations and transcribe them materially.
Higher up, there is
a fourth zone, a zone of coloured lights, plays of coloured
lights. That's the order: first form, then sound, then ideas,
then coloured lights. But that zone is already more distant from
humanity; it is a zone of forces, a zone which appears as
coloured lights. No forms - coloured lights representing forces.
And one can combine these forces so that they work in the
terrestrial atmosphere and bring about certain events. It's a
zone of action, independent of form, sound and thought; it is
above all that. A zone of active power and might you can use for
a particular purpose - if you have the capacity to do so.
That's the highest
zone.
Thus we have form,
expressed in painting, sculpture or architecture; sound,
expressed in musical themes; and thought, expressed in books,
plays, novels, or even in philosophical and other kinds of
intellectual theories
And above this zone, free of form,
sound and though, is the play of forces appearing as coloured
lights. And when you go there and have the power, you can
combine those forces so that they eventually materialise as
creations on earth (it takes some time, it's rarely immediate)
Question:
In short, when one rises to that Origin, one finds a single
vibration, which can be expressed as music or thought or
architectural or pictorial forms - is that right?
Yes, but it goes
through specific transformations en route. It passes through one
zone or another, where it undergoes transformations to adapt
itself to the particular mode of expression. The waves of music
are one particular mode of expression of those coloured waves -
they should really be called "luminous" waves, for
they are self-luminous. Waves of coloured light. Great waves of
coloured light.
(silence)
All those zones of
artistic creation are very high up in human consciousness, which
is
why art can be a wonderful tool for spiritual progress.
